The content primarily focuses on educating mineral rights owners about managing their rights and royalties in the oil and gas industry. Episodes often tackle practical advice involving mineral ownership, taxation issues, and estate planning while addressing real-world challenges faced by listeners. A notable aspect of the podcast is its blend of technical knowledge with accessible explanations, making complex topics understandable for both novice and experienced mineral owners. Additionally, hosts share industry news that affects mineral rights, keeping listeners informed about relevant legal and market trends, which is valuable for decision-making in this niche field.
